Synopsis
"Tiny" (2021), featuring Danni Rivers, is an intimate drama that explores the complexities of personal growth and self-acceptance. The film delves into the protagonist's journey to come to terms with her identity while navigating various emotional challenges and relationships. Its poignant storytelling and nuanced performances invite viewers to reflect on themes of vulnerability, resilience, and the search for meaning in everyday life. With a subtle yet evocative narrative style, "Tiny" captures the essence of human connection and the courage it takes to embrace one's true self.
Reviews
"Tiny" received a mixed to positive reception from critics. On Rotten Tomatoes, the film holds a modest approval rating, with critics praising its heartfelt performances and authentic portrayal of emotional struggles, though some noted its pacing as uneven. IMDb users gave it an average rating around 6.5/10, indicating a generally favorable but divided audience response. Metacritic's score reflects a similar consensus, highlighting the strong acting by Danni Rivers as a standout element. Reviewers from outlets like IndieWire commented, "While the narrative occasionally loses momentum, the film's sincerity and character depth make it a compelling watch." The Guardian noted, "Tiny's intimate storytelling resonates, though it might not appeal to all viewers due to its subtle pacing." Overall, "Tiny" is recognized for its thoughtful exploration of personal themes, even if it doesn't break new ground in cinematic storytelling.
